Description

Performs a power analysis for estimating the heritability of a binomial trait. This function can take a long time to run if either nsims or nperms is large.

Usage

1
binomPower(ndads, mm, vv, tau2, nperms, nsims, nbins, alpha = 0.05, doPlot=FALSE)

Arguments

ndads

a (non-empty) numeric value indicating the number of dads.

mm

a (non-empty) numeric value indicating the mean number of offspring per dad per bin (normal dist). mm must be less than vv.

vv

a (non-empty) numeric value indicating the variance in offspring per dad per bin (normal dist). vv. must be greater than mm.

tau2

a (non-empty) numeric value indicating the dad effect (narrow-sense heritability ~ tau2/(tau2+(pi/sqrt(3))^2)).

nperms

a (non-empty) numeric value indicating the number of bootstrap permutations to use for caluclating a p value.

nsims

a (non-empty) numeric value indicating the number of simulations to run per parameter combination.

nbins

a (non-empty) numeric value indicating the number of bins, data are pooled before analysis.

alpha

a (non-empty) numeric value indicating the cutoff for significant p values.

doPlot

a (non-empty) logical value indicating whether to plot the results of the power analysis.

Value

Returns a list and an optional set of .pdfs (if doPlot==TRUE). The list contains:

roc

a data.frame with the summarized results of the power analysis.

params

a numeric matrix with the paramater values.

results

a numeric matrix with the full results of the analysis.
